### Supported File Formats
#### Import
We currently offer support for importing the following:
* **MD (Markdown)**: You can import individual `.md` files or a zip file containing multiple Markdown files. Please note that relations are not exported at this time.
* **HTML**
* **TXT**
* **CSV**
* **Any-Block**:
* **Protobuf**
* **JSON**
{% hint style="info" %}
After your import is done, a new collection should appear in your favorites widget in your sidebar. All of your imported objects should be there.
{% endhint %}
#### Export
We currently offer support for exporting in the following formats:
* **Markdown**
* **Any-Block** (both Protobuf and JSON)
